As of September 2019, the eight states that require only an associate's degree for LNHA licensure are Alabama, Arkansas, Colorado, Mississippi, Nebraska, North Carolina, South Dakota and Tennessee. . At least three years of experience in health-care administration OR; An associate degree in health-care administration with at least 21 semester hours of course work directly in health-care administration OR; Baccalaureate or Masters degree in one of the following: Health-care administration; Gerontology (including a long-term care practicum, internship, or both); Nursing (BSN or diploma nurse) OR; Experience AND education in one of the following areas: Associate degree and two years of experience in a health-care facility OR; Baccalaureate degree and one year of experience in a health-care facility OR; Masters degree or beyond and one year of experience in a health-care facility.
